Script Alrud 8 is a light, narrow, very high cont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A delicate, calligraphic script with pronounced stroke modulation: hairline entry/exit strokes expand into thicker downstrokes, creating a crisp, high-contrast rhythm. Letterforms are slender and slightly slanted, with long ascenders/descenders and frequent loops, especially in capitals and in letters like g, y, and z. Connections are fluid in running text, while many capitals behave like stand-alone initials with extended lead-in strokes and occasional swash-like terminals. The overall texture is airy, with generous internal counters and a springy baseline that feels hand-drawn yet consistent.

Best suited for display and short-form text where its fine hairlines and flourished forms can be appreciated—wedding suites, event stationery, beauty or boutique branding, product packaging, and pull quotes. It pairs well with simple serif or sans companions for body copy, while this script handles names, headings, and accent lines.

The font conveys a polished, romantic tone with a light, graceful energy. Its looping forms and fine hairlines add a hint of whimsy, while the controlled contrast and tidy joins keep it feeling refined and intentional.

Designed to emulate formal pen lettering with elegant contrast and ornamental capitals, offering a graceful signature-like voice for expressive, premium-facing typography. The emphasis appears to be on stylish word shapes and decorative initials rather than dense, small-size readability.

Capitals are notably more decorative than lowercase, featuring tall verticals and elongated cross-strokes that can create lively word shapes in headline settings. Numerals follow the same calligraphic logic, mixing thin entry strokes with thicker stems and occasional curls, which keeps them stylistically coherent beside the letters.
